Responsibilities
- Facilitate team-level Agile ceremonies such as Daily Stand-ups, Iteration Planning, Backlog Refinement, Iteration Reviews, and Retrospectives.
- Guide the team in becoming high-performing, self-organizing, and self-managing within the context of the ART.
- Actively participate in and support ART-level events such as PI Planning, Scrum of Scrums (SoS), Inspect & Adapt (I&A), and System Demos.
- Serve as a key liaison between the team and Release Train Engineer (RTE), ensuring alignment with ART objectives and cadence.
- Collaborate with Product Owners and teams to support backlog refinement, story writing, and estimation, ensuring alignment to PI objectives and business value delivery.
- Identify, escalate, and help remove systemic impediments through collaboration with other Scrum Masters, RTEs, and functional managers.
- Foster transparency and synchronization by radiating information via Jira, Confluence, and other SAFe tooling (e.g., VersionOne, Rally).
- Track and communicate Agile metrics (velocity, sprint/iteration burndown, team health, etc.) to promote empirical decision-making.
- Promote a Lean-Agile mindset and SAFe Core Values by coaching team members, stakeholders, and leaders on Agile and SAFe principles and practices.
- Facilitate cross-team coordination and dependency management in collaboration with other Scrum Masters and the RTE.
- Champion relentless improvement by supporting team and ART-level retrospective outcomes and facilitating actionable follow-up.
- Act as a servant leader and Agile coach, continuously mentoring team members in Agile practices and principles.
- Encourage alignment with Team and ART-level Objectives, ensuring the team is working toward shared outcomes and delivering value every Program Increment (PI).
- Leverage an engaging and approachable demeanor to build trust, motivate teams, and foster a safe environment for open communication and feedback.
- Bring positive energy and emotional intelligence to team interactions, helping to navigate conflict, celebrate wins, and cultivate psychological safety.
